Last Listing description (October 2022)

Owners plans have changed. Newly built Stroud home with Pacific Harbour Golf Course outlook. Totaling 5 bedrooms, 3 bathrooms, 4 toilets, 3 garages, open plan living + incorporates a self contained living space which has its own garage, 1 bedroom, Lounge/dining + an office with its own powder room. Great dual living for the extended family, or use as a home office. Land area of 713m2, and floor area is 324m2.
Main home well fitted out and also includes a media room, walk-in pantry, gas cook top and a 5000 litre rain water tank, and a garden viewing space with skylight under roof. Alfresco patio to rear. Quality throughout.

About Banksia Beach 4507

The size of Banksia Beach is approximately 7.2 square kilometres. There are 24 parks, covering nearly 51.5% of the total area. The population of Banksia Beach in 2016 was 5995 people. By 2021 the population was 7180 showing a population growth of 19.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Banksia Beach is 60-69 years. Households in Banksia Beach are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Banksia Beach work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 84.50% of the homes in Banksia Beach were owner-occupied compared with 79.60% in 2016.

Banksia Beach has 4,347 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Banksia Beach have seen a 73.72%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 87.72% increase. As at 31 July 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Banksia Beach is $1,263,968 while the median value for Units is $928,315.
  • Houses have a median rent of $763.
There are currently 72 properties listed for sale, and 5 properties listed for rent in Banksia beach on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 196 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Banksia beach.
